Where is Köln Sülz Lindenburg?

Where is Köln Sülz Lindenburg located?

Köln Sülz Lindenburg, Köln Sülz Lindenburg, Germany (approx. 50.92218°, 6.921492°)


Where is Köln Sülz Lindenburg on the map?